Specifications
Series: Z-Sensor
Part Status: Active
Sensing Method: Proximity
Sensing Distance: 0.197" ~ 6.102" (5mm ~ 155mm)
Voltage - Supply: 10 V ~ 30 V
Response Time: --
Output Configuration: PNP
Connection Method: Cable with Connector
Ingress Protection: IP67
Cable Length: 5.906" (150.00mm)
Light Source: Infrared (880nm)
Adjustment Type: --
Operating Temperature: -25°C ~ 50°C (TA)
